51040415504 has 40 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 106626925440. Its totient is φ = 23528550528.
The previous prime is 51040415479. The next prime is 51040415507. The reversal of 51040415504 is 40551404015.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(51040415507)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 23657 + ... + 320375.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(2665673136).
Almost surely, 251040415504 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
51040415504 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(55586509936).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
51040415504 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
51040415504 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 297567 (or 297561 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 8000, while the sum is 29.
Adding to 51040415504 its reverse (40551404015), we get a palindrome (91591819519).
